How much CGPA is required for changing branch?

Students who wish to change their branch must complete all the credits required in the first two semesters of their studies. CGPA must not lower than 8.5 at the end of the second semester.

Can I change my Branch in IIT Mandi?

1. To be considered for a branch change, the student will have to submit an application before the end of the second semester of her/his programme. The applicant will have to specify the choices, in order of preference, of the branch or branches that she/he seeks a change to.

In which NIT branch change is possible?

Generally, all the NITs offer students to change their branch after first year. Like in NIT Rourkela and Warangal and Delhi, B. Tech students who have secured CGPA of 8.5 or more and have passed all the credits prescribed in first attempt at the end of the first year are eligible to change their branch.

What is the difference between CGPA and SGPA?

No. CGPA stands for Cumulative Grade Point Average which is the sum total of the SGPA’s of all semesters or that of an academic year. SGPA, on the other hand, are the grades obtained in one semester. How is CGPA calculated for all semesters? CGPA= Sum total of all SGPA/Total credit hours of the program
